本文目录导读:
随着互联网技术的飞速发展,负载均衡技术在提高系统可用性、性能和可靠性方面发挥着越来越重要的作用,负载均衡控制器作为实现负载均衡的关键设备,其工作原理和性能优劣直接影响到整个系统的稳定性,本文将通过对负载均衡控制器原理的图解,深入解析其工作机制与优势。
负载均衡控制器原理图解
1、负载均衡控制器架构
负载均衡控制器通常采用分布式架构,主要包括以下组件:
(1)负载均衡器:负责接收客户端请求,并根据一定的算法将请求分发到后端服务器。
图片来源于网络,如有侵权联系删除
(2)后端服务器:处理客户端请求,提供所需服务。
(3)监控模块:实时监控后端服务器的性能,包括CPU、内存、带宽等指标。
(4)配置管理模块:负责配置负载均衡器的各项参数,如调度算法、健康检查等。
2、工作流程
(1)客户端请求:客户端向负载均衡器发送请求。
(2)请求分发:负载均衡器根据预设的调度算法,将请求分发到后端服务器。
(3)请求处理:后端服务器处理客户端请求,并返回响应。
(4)性能监控:监控模块实时监控后端服务器的性能指标。
(5)动态调整:当监控模块检测到后端服务器性能下降时,负载均衡器会根据预设的规则调整请求分发策略,将请求分发到性能较好的服务器。
负载均衡控制器工作原理
1、调度算法
负载均衡控制器采用多种调度算法,常见的有以下几种:
图片来源于网络,如有侵权联系删除
(1)轮询(Round Robin):按照请求顺序将请求分发到各个后端服务器。
(2)最少连接(Least Connections):将请求分发到连接数最少的服务器,降低服务器负载。
(3)IP哈希(IP Hash):根据客户端IP地址,将请求分发到具有相同IP后缀的后端服务器。
(4)URL哈希(URL Hash):根据请求的URL,将请求分发到具有相同URL后缀的后端服务器。
2、健康检查
负载均衡控制器通过健康检查机制,实时监控后端服务器的运行状态,常见的健康检查方法有:
(1)HTTP健康检查:通过发送HTTP请求,判断后端服务器是否正常运行。
(2)TCP健康检查:通过建立TCP连接,判断后端服务器是否正常运行。
(3)ICMP健康检查:通过发送ICMP请求,判断后端服务器是否正常运行。
3、负载均衡策略
负载均衡控制器采用多种负载均衡策略,以提高系统性能和可靠性,常见的策略有:
图片来源于网络,如有侵权联系删除
(1)流量分配:根据后端服务器的性能,动态调整请求分发比例。
(2)会话保持:将客户端会话绑定到特定的后端服务器,提高用户体验。
(3)故障转移:当后端服务器出现故障时,自动将请求分发到其他正常服务器。
负载均衡控制器优势
1、提高系统可用性:通过负载均衡,将请求分发到多个后端服务器,降低单点故障风险,提高系统可用性。
2、提高系统性能:合理分配请求,降低后端服务器负载,提高系统处理能力。
3、提高系统可靠性:通过健康检查和故障转移机制,及时发现并解决后端服务器故障,提高系统可靠性。
4、降低运维成本:负载均衡控制器简化了运维工作,降低运维成本。
负载均衡控制器作为实现负载均衡的关键设备,其工作原理和性能优劣直接影响到整个系统的稳定性,通过对负载均衡控制器原理的图解,本文深入解析了其工作机制与优势,有助于读者更好地理解和应用负载均衡技术。
标签: #负载均衡控制器原理
评论列表